We recently attended the cocktail launch party for ModeWalk.com, a new shopping site which has been featured by Vogue, New York Times, Town & Country, the Harvard Business Review and Style.com. Hosted by Allison Huynh Hassan, Alison Pincus and Christine Suppes at the beautiful Pacific Heights penthouse of Isha and Asim Abdullah, the event brought together San Francisco’s best dressed women with figures from fashion media and e-commerce.

Described as an “immersive shopping experience for discovering the world’s finest luxury treasures,” ModeWalk.com has found an important niche in the field of luxury online shopping by providing previously unavailable access to some of the most desired brands in the world.

The company has launched by being the first website to offer true French haute couture from Alexis Mabille, Alexandre Vauthier, Christophe Josse, Gustavo Lins, Maxime Simoens and On Aura Tout Vu — designers who are members of the prestigious Chambre Syndicale de la Haute Couture, and winners of French fashion awards.
Ready-to-Wear, shoes, and accessories are available from Andrew Gn (a designer who is widely favored in San Francisco), Anne Valerie Hash, Azzaro, Cesaire, Helene Zubeldia, Laura Do, Lefranc- Ferrant, Larare, Marion Vidal, Mallarino, Martin Grant, Nyamanti, Philippe Ferrandis, Phillipe Roucou, Ragazze Ornamentali, Rochas, Thierry Lasry and Vouelle.

With a management team which includes co-founders Beatrice Pang, Henri Deshays and Ragi Burhum, Mara Behrens and Indre Rockefeller, the company has an esteemed group of advisors, such as Vincent Bastien (the former CEO of Louis Vuitton), Paul Deneve (the CEO of Yves Saint Laurent and former CEO of Lanvin and Nina Ricci), Bruce Jaffe (the CFO of Glam Media) Jon Fahrner, Patricia Lerat, Faisal Masud and Professor Baba Shiv.
By the amount of attention the new company has been getting, it seems well on its way at taking on the net-a-porter and gilt.com’s of the world, with a panache that combines the ingenuity of Silicon Valley and the sophistication of French design. The SF Conservatory of Music Gala Pre-Party
Deepa Pakianathan and Phil Pemberton recently hosted a reception for the San Francisco Conservatory of Music in anticipation of its upcoming Gala on April 20, 2013, which pays tribute to legendary opera baritone and Conservatory Advisory Board member Thomas Hampson.
Conservatory mezzo-soprano Catherine Cook directs and stars in a program featuring special performances by Hampson with Conservatory students, faculty and guest artists. Teresa Medearis and Barbara Walkowski co-chair the event, with catering by McCall’s Catering and Events and decor by Blueprint Studios.

Partners in Care Kicks Off
UCSF Partners in Care recently held its 2013 kick-off membership event at Reed & Greenough. Membership co-Chairs Schuyler Hudak and Libby Leffler hosted the launch party and kicked off the well-attended evening with brief remarks, followed by UCSF Partners in Care President Katie Budge, who spoke about the services that the auxiliary organization provides to the hospital.
UCSF Partners in Care works with UCSF hospital staff to fund programs that provide comfort and well-being to patients and their families while visiting the UCSF medical center.
Guests enjoyed spirited greyhounds nicknamed “Doctor’s Orders,” and a “Members Only” wine special while noshing on sweet treats from Kara’s Cupakes, and savory sliders and arancini from Cedar Hill Kitchen and Smokehouse.

Madeleine Pauw at Saks Fifth Avenue
Renowned European designer Ms. Madeline Pauw recently made an appearance at a delightful luncheon at Saks Fifth Avenue in San Francisco, where her Spring 2013 collection was presented.
The Pauw collection is designed by Madeleine Pauw, daughter of the original founders. Pauw is known for its luxurious fabrics and soft touches of femininity while integrating just a splash of masculine undertones, but always keeping the fit and style in mind for the female physique. The company has been in business for over 50 years, and originally was created in the Netherlands where it currently has 29 stores.
